Answer to Question 1

2, 4, 5
Explanation: 2. Periodic breathing with pauses longer than 20 seconds (apnea) is an abnormal finding that should be reported to the physician.
4. Grunting on expiration is an abnormal finding that should be reported to the physician.
5. Nasal flaring is an abnormal finding that should be reported to the physician.

Answer to Question 2

3
Explanation: 3. The nurse's attitude of acceptance and matter-of-factness conveys to the client that she is still an acceptable person who happens to have an infection.
